Part of him noticed the kid moving to a safer, less visible spot in the street. Smart, said that part. Knows how to keep out of danger. But not a very soldierly thing to do. He had to focus away pretty quickly, though, as the door shuddered on its hinges and nearly gave way. He pulled the gun back up and bashed the lock again, and this time it broke. The door flew inward and had he not stopped it by moving into the room, it likely would have slammed shut again.

The bayonet was up and the sight aimed, swinging around to make sure there were no threats - a throwback to the military days, but still useful - and he was rewarded by the sight of someone trying to charge at him and take him down with an entire chair. His body took over as he dodged back, hitting the wall and letting the chair smash against the ground, a leg breaking off with the force of it. Before the attacking man could heft it back up again, William had the butt of the bayonet swinging around to bash him in the skull.

One down. He whirled and faced the rest of the room, where two other men, unarmed, were crouched and ready to attack with their fists, though the sight of their ally going down without a struggle had stopped them in their tracks. There was wariness in their eyes.

make it fear make them fear insufferable creatures you seek to destroy me but i am beyond you i am beyond all

With the Hessian all but shrieking in his head, Will approached the two men. One shrank back; the other stayed where he was, torn between fight and flight. Later, some part of him would wonder at why they didn't attack him outright; there was two of them, one of him, and he didn't have them by surprise. He didn't quite understand where their fear came from.
